本书介绍了VxWorks 操作系统的常用函数库,并对库中各函数进行了详细描述。全书共12章,主要内容包括:任务管理与调度函数、任务同步与通信函数、时钟管理函数、中断管理函数、I/O系统函数、文化系统函数、系统内核函数、用户函数、浮点函数、网络系统函数和错误状态函数等。\r\n 本书语言通畅、条理清晰、内容全面且深入浅出,以精选实例加文字说明的方式结合编者多年的实际开发经验编写而成。它是VxWorks 程序员的案头参考书,无论是VxWorks 初学者还是资深程序员都能从中受益匪浅。
前言\r\n第1章 任务管理与调度\r\n 1.1 任务管理函数\r\n 1.2 任务信息函数\r\n 1.3 任务显示函数\r\n 1.4 任务钩子管理函数\r\n 1.5 任务钩子显示函数\r\n 1.6 任务变量函数\r\n 1.7 体系结构相关任务管理函数\r\n第2章 任务间同步与通信\r\n 2.1 信号量\r\n 2.2 消息队列\r\n 2.3 管道\r\n 2.4 信号\r\n第3章 时钟管理\r\n 3.1 ANSI时间管理函数\r\n 3.2 时钟TICK管理函数\r\n 3.3 看门狗定时器\r\n 3.4 看门狗显示函数\r\n 3.5 执行计量器函数\r\n第4章 中断管理\r\n 4.1 与体系结构无关的中断函数\r\n 4.2 与体系结构相关的中断函数\r\n 4.3 VxWorks 内核描述\r\n第5章 VxWorks 内存管理\r\n 5.1 完全内存区管理函数\r\n 5.2 核心内存区管理函数\r\n 5.3 内存区显示函数\r\n 5.4 缓冲区处理函数\r\n第6章 VxWorks 的I/O系统\r\n 6.1 I/O应用接口函数\r\n 6.2 I/O系统函数\r\n 6.3 I/O系统显示函数\r\n 6.4 格式化I/O函数\r\n 6.5 select函数\r\n第7章 文件系统API\r\n 7.1 与MS-DOS系统兼容的文件系统函数\r\n 7.2 原始文件系统函数\r\n 7.3 磁带设计文件系统函数\r\n 7.4 CD-ROM文件系统函数\r\n第8章 系统内核函数\r\n 8.1 系统相关函数\r\n 8.2 VxWorks 内核函数\r\n第9章 用户部分\r\n 9.1 用户接口子程序\r\n 9.2 自定义系统配置函数\r\n第10章 浮点函数\r\n 10.1 浮点I/O支持函数\r\n 10.2 与体系结构相关的浮点协处理器支持函数\r\n 10.3 浮点协处理器支持函数\r\n 10.4 浮点显示函数\r\n第11章 VxWorks 网络系统\r\n ……\r\n第12章 错误状态函数\r\n附录
随着VxWorks操作系统在嵌入式领域越来越广泛的应用,一种新的书籍需求正在形成。即编程者需要多种相关的速查手册。该书的出版正是为了适应这样的需求,为广大程序员提供最大的便利。为了能做到给程序员提供正确的帮助,书中的函数说明力争可以完全地符合WindRiver公司所提供的说明文档,而所有的例子则尽量使用公开的程序片断。
本书适合于使用VxWorks操作系统的人,不论是入门级的或是资深级的程序员都可以将本书作为函数速查手册使用。书中提供了一些例子和函数库的详细说明,使得该书也可以作为VxWorks的参考手册来使用。在书中,很多函数库的说明较为详细,可以对其他的资料作一定程度的补充。
本书包括了任务的调度和管理、终端管理、系统时钟的管理、内存管理、IO系统、文件系统、网络系统、用户接口、异常处理等诸多分类的函数。在函数的选材上,我们希望能包含所有的常用的函数,但有很多函数库和函数的使用程度是我们无法预料的,希望读者能将意见及时地反馈给我们。
该书由周启平和张杨合作完成,其中第1~4、9、11章由周启平完成,第5~8、10、12章由张杨完成。例子的添加与测试,章节的修改、校对等工作,是由周启平和张杨共同完成的。在此,向所有支持本书编写的人员表示感谢。
同时还要感谢出版社的编辑们、我们的亲友和同事在该书出版过程中对我们的帮助和鼓励。尽管抱着认真的态度,但在书中还是难免会出现各种各样的错误,希望各位读者能不吝赐教。
我们的联系方式:
周启平:qpzhou@sina.com
张杨:hwybird@sOhu.cOm